Duplicate Movie Flash Mx

I CANT GET THIS SLOPE FORMULA TO WORK WITH THE DUPLICATE MOVIE CLIP. I NEED IT TO SHOOT AND THE POINT THAT MY SHIP IS POINTED BUT I CANT FIGURE IT OUT. HERES THE SLOPE CODE FOR MY SHIP AND IM USING FLASH MX

if (Key.isDown(Key.UP)){
speed = 15;
if (slopeship._rotation < 0) {
if (slopeship._rotation < -90){
mod = (slopeship._rotation+90) / -90;
slopeship._x-=speed*(1-mod);
slopeship._y+=speedmod;
} else {
mod = slopeship._rotation / -90;
slopeship._x-=speed
mod;
slopeship._y-=speed*(1-mod);
}

} else {
	if (slopeship._rotation &gt; 90){
		mod = (slopeship._rotation-90) / 90;
		slopeship._x+=speed*(1-mod);
		slopeship._y+=speed*mod;
	} else {
		mod = slopeship._rotation / 90;
		slopeship._x+=speed*mod;
		slopeship._y-=speed*(1-mod);
	 }
}

}
if (Key.isDown(Key.RIGHT)){
turnSped = 10;
_root.slopeship._rotation+=turnSped;
}
if (Key.isDown(Key.LEFT)){
turnSped = 10;
_root.slopeship._rotation-=turnSped;
}